What is Curiosity?

Curiosity is the desire to learn or know something. It’s the driving force behind our questions, our explorations, and our discoveries. When we’re curious about something, we’re more likely to engage with it, to think about it, and to share it with others. As humans, we’re naturally curious creatures, and tapping into this curiosity can be a powerful way to connect with others and achieve our goals.

The Psychology of Curiosity

So, what makes us curious? According to psychologists, curiosity is driven by a combination of factors, including our desire for knowledge, our need for novelty, and our fear of the unknown. When we encounter something new or unexpected, our brains are wired to respond with curiosity, to try to make sense of it and understand it. This is why surprise, intrigue, and mystery can be such powerful tools for creating curiosity.

The Role of Surprise

Surprise is a key element in creating curiosity. When we encounter something unexpected, it grabs our attention and makes us want to learn more. This can be as simple as a surprising fact or statistic, or as complex as a unexpected plot twist in a story. The key is to create a sense of surprise that sparks our curiosity and makes us want to engage with what we’re seeing or hearing.

The Power of Intrigue

Intrigue is another powerful tool for creating curiosity. When we’re intrigued by something, we’re drawn to it, we want to learn more about it, and we’re more likely to engage with it. This can be achieved through the use of questions, puzzles, or mysteries that need to be solved. By creating a sense of intrigue, we can tap into people’s natural curiosity and make them more likely to share what they’re seeing or hearing with others.
